Well, wait to see what happens when I get some more data added. I'd assume that the top prospects will generally throw more pitchers than the lower ranked guys so that number will likely drop as more data is added.
I don't think that's a wise assumption. I live in an area that produces very few Division I-caliber baseball players and even less MLB Draft-caliber players, and most high school pitchers throw three or more pitches. They obviously aren't particularly good in the grand scheme, but many kids who can't break 80 mph with their fastball still throw a breaking ball and a third pitch (changeup, cutter, etc.).

Considering you're taking data from Perfect Game, which typically deals with the better high school players, I'm confident that the average stays above three pitches.
